Mental Processing and Its Therapeutic Applications
Cognitive behavior encompasses the intricate functions by which individuals interpret information, make choices, and regulate their feelings. Treatment-oriented applications of cognitive psychotherapeutic approaches aim to modify these tendencies to diminish psychological distress and boost overall well-being. Through techniques such as cognitive restructuring, therapists guide clients in identifying and challenging unhelpful beliefs that contribute to emotional anguish. This process can lead to beneficial changes in behavior, coping mechanisms, and ultimately, a improved quality of life.
Certification in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y
In today's dynamic therapeutic landscape, acquiring specialized training like CBT certification has become increasingly crucial for professionals aiming to provide effective and evidence-based care. CBT certification equips practitioners with the skills necessary to effectively implement cognitive behavioral therapy techniques. Through rigorous coursework and supervised clinical experience, certified professionals gain a deep understanding of how thoughts, feelings, and behaviors interact to one another. This comprehensive training allows them to implement personalized treatment plans tailored to the unique needs of their clients, addressing a wide range of mental health issues. Furthermore, CBT certification demonstrates a commitment to professional growth, enhancing credibility and fostering public belief in the practitioner's expertise.
